How much do jr network admin j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 23, 2026, the average hourly pay for jr network admin in the United States is $30.06,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$24.76 and $35.10 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by Jr Network Admins in their daily work?

Jr Network Admins often encounter challenges such as troubleshooting connectivity issues, managing network hardware configurations, and ensuring consistent network security. Balancing routine maintenance with urgent user support requests can be demanding, especially in larger organizations. Additionally, Jr Network Admins may need to quickly learn new technologies or adapt to evolving cybersecurity threats, making ongoing learning and adaptability important skills for success in this role.

What is the difference between Jr Network Admin vs Network Technician?

AspectJr Network AdminNetwork Technician
CertificationsCompTIA Network+, Cisco CCNA (preferred)CompTIA Network+, Cisco CCNA (preferred)
Work EnvironmentAssist in network management, configuration, and troubleshootingFocus on hardware setup, repairs, and basic troubleshooting
Employer UsageIT departments, managed service providersTelecom companies, IT support firms

While both roles require similar certifications and work in network environments, Jr Network Admins typically handle network management and configuration, whereas Network Technicians focus more on hardware and physical network issues. The Jr Network Admin role often involves more administrative and planning responsibilities, making it suitable for those looking to advance into network management.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Jr Network Admin,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Jr Network Admin, you need a solid understanding of networking fundamentals, TCP/IP protocols, and basic troubleshooting, typically supported by an associate degree or CompTIA Network+ certification. Familiarity with network monitoring tools, Cisco or Juniper devices, and Windows or Linux server environments is commonly required. Strong probl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help you excel in supporting users and collaborating with IT teams. These competencies ensure efficient network operations, minimize downtime, and support overall organizational productivity.

What does a Jr Network Admin do?

A Jr Network Admin, or Junior Network Administrator, is responsible for assisting with the maintenance, monitoring, and troubleshooting of an organization’s computer networks. They help ensure network security, perform routine updates, and support other IT staff with resolving connectivity issues. Their role often includes setting up network hardware, managing user accounts, and documenting network configurations. This position is usually entry-level, providing a foundation for more advanced network administration roles.
